Le Train Rouge (1973)
Directed by Peter Ammann
Share on
Synopsis by Clarke Fountain
Because so many of the Italian "guest workers" who live in Switzerland are leftists, the train they take back to Italy in order to vote is called The Red Train. This Swiss documentary explores their situation in Switzerland, and their politics. Often living in the country for many years, perhaps even their entire adult lives, Italian guest workers in Switzerland are forbidden to bring their families to live with them.
